INGREDIENTS :
- 12 large scallops, patted dry
- 12 slices of bacon (preferably thick-cut)
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- Salt and black pepper, to taste
- 1 tablespoon f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)
- Lemon wedges, for serving (optional)
How to Make Bacon-Wrapped Scallops
INSTRUCTIONS :
- Preheat the oven: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at for easy cleanup.
- Prepare the bacon: Cut the bacon slices in half to create smaller strips that will fit around the scallops. If you prefer extra crispiness, you can partially cook the bacon in a skillet over medium heat for 3-4 minutes before wrapping it around the scallops. This step is optional.
- Season the scallops: Pat the scallops dry with paper towels to remove any excess moisture. This ensures a crispy sear. Season both sides with salt, pepper, and garlic powder.
- Wrap the scallops: Wrap each scallop with a half slice of bacon, securing it with a toothpick. Arrange the wrapped scallops on the prepared baking sheet.
- Cook the bacon-wrapped scallops: Drizzle the olive oil over the bacon-wrapped scallops and place the baking sheet in the preheated oven.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until the bacon is crispy and the scallops are opaque and tender.
- Finish with lemon: Once done, remove the scallops from the oven. Drizzle them with fresh lemon juice and garnish with chopped parsley.
- Serve and enjoy: Serve immediately with lemon wedges for an extra burst of flavor.
NOTES :
- Substitutions: You can swap the scallops for shrimp or use turkey bacon for a lighter version.
- For extra flavor: Add a pinch of smoked paprika or cayenne pepper to the seasoning mix for a smoky kick.
- Make it spicy: Add a small amount of hot sauce to the scallops before wrapping them in bacon for some heat.
- Serving ideas: Serve with a side of fresh vegetables, a simple salad, or as part of a seafood platter.
NUTRITION FACTS (Per Serving – 2 scallops)
- Calories: 180
- Protein: 15g
- Carbs: 1g
- Fat: 13g
- Fiber: 0g
